Wondering what NVIDIA software is included in NVIDIA AI Enterprise?

NVIDIA AI Enterprise is a comprehensive software suite designed to operationalize and scale artificial intelligence across enterprise data centers and cloud environments. It is not a single application but a curated, licensed collection of NVIDIA's key software libraries, frameworks, and tools, all optimized, certified, and supported for production deployment. The suite's primary purpose is to provide a stable, secure, and supported software layer that sits atop NVIDIA's hardware infrastructure, such as data center GPUs, to streamline the development, deployment, and management of AI workloads. This transforms advanced AI from a research and development exercise into a reliable, integrated component of enterprise IT.

The software included spans the full AI workflow. For the foundational model training and inference layer, it encompasses core frameworks like TensorFlow and PyTorch, which are optimized and containerized as the NVIDIA NGC containers. It also includes NVIDIA's own high-performance libraries, such as the CUDA Toolkit for parallel computing, cuDNN for deep neural networks, and the Triton Inference Server for deploying models from any framework at scale. For the critical data processing and preparation stage, the suite incorporates the RAPIDS suite of open-source software libraries, which enables GPU-accelerated data science and analytics pipelines. Furthermore, it provides enterprise-grade MLOps and workflow tools, notably the NVIDIA AI Enterprise Workflow Manager, which guides users through a supported, end-to-end pipeline from data preparation to model deployment, and the NVIDIA TAO Toolkit for simplifying model adaptation with transfer learning.

Beyond these core development and deployment tools, the suite includes specialized runtimes and application frameworks for key enterprise use cases. This includes the NVIDIA Clara suite for healthcare and life sciences applications, the NVIDIA Metropolis for vision AI and video analytics, and the NVIDIA Riva for building conversational AI services. Importantly, NVIDIA AI Enterprise also incorporates management and virtualization software crucial for IT administrators, such as the NVIDIA AI Enterprise with VMware vSphere support, which includes the NVIDIA vGPU software for efficiently sharing GPU resources across multiple virtual machines. The entire collection is distributed as a licensed subscription, providing organizations with long-term branch support, security updates, and direct access to NVIDIA's enterprise support channels, ensuring stability for production systems.

The strategic implication of this bundled offering is that it allows enterprises to de-risk their AI infrastructure investments. By providing a single, certified software stack with consistent APIs and long-term support, NVIDIA reduces the integration complexity and compatibility challenges that often plague large-scale AI deployments. It effectively creates a standardized, vendor-supported platform that bridges the gap between cutting-edge AI research, embodied in rapidly evolving open-source projects, and the rigorous requirements of enterprise IT for security, stability, and manageability. Therefore, NVIDIA AI Enterprise is less about providing novel, exclusive software and more about curating, hardening, and supporting the essential tools required to build and run AI, thereby accelerating the transition of AI projects from prototype to production.

References